Tallahassee preview: lobbyist tells Sebring council lawmakers will file thousands of bills; property-tax proposals loom Lobbyist Ken Pruitt told Sebring council that the Florida legislative session will begin Jan. 13, with nearly 900 bills already filed and a likely 2,000+ total; he flagged the governor’s $117 billion budget recommendation and a proposed $200,000 homestead exemption as items the city is closely watching.

Lakeshore Housing Alliance warns HUD rule changes could put 400 local households at risk Christina Ford of the Lakeshore Housing Alliance told the commission that proposed HUD FY2025 funding rules — including a reduction in guaranteed renewals and a cap on permanent housing funding — could jeopardize more than 400 Ottawa County households and asked for flexible bridge funding from HUD.

Carroll County commissioners join filings opposing PSEG power-line schedule, cite property-rights and water-supply concerns in New Windsor Commissioners said Oct. 30 they filed two motions with the Maryland Public Service Commission (PSC) seeking denial of PSEG's request for an abbreviated procedural schedule and seeking dismissal of the proposed power-line project. St. Mary's County commissioners approve letter urging senators to pass clean continuing resolution St. Mary's County commissioners voted unanimously to send a letter to U.S. Sens. Chuck Schumer, Chris Van Hollen and Angela Alsobrooks urging passage of a "clean" continuing resolution to reopen the federal government, citing local impacts tied to Patuxent River Naval Air Station.
